Rock and roll continues to be referred to as a merger of state music and rhythm and blues, but, if it ended up that straightforward, it would've existed extended right before it burst in the countrywide consciousness. The seeds from the music were in place for many years, However they flowered during the mid-1950s when nourished by a volatile mixture of Black culture and white investing electrical power. Black vocal teams including the Dominoes and also the Spaniels started combining gospel-model harmonies and get in touch with-and-response singing with earthy subject material and much more aggressive rhythm-and-blues rhythms.

Rock musicians inside the mid-sixties started to advance the album in advance of the single as being the dominant type of recorded music expression and intake, Using the Beatles for the forefront of the advancement. Their contributions lent the style a cultural legitimacy during the mainstream and initiated a rock-educated album period within the music market for the next many many years. Through the late sixties "classic rock"[3] period, a number of distinct rock music subgenres had emerged, which includes hybrids like blues rock, folks rock, country rock, Southern rock, raga rock, and jazz rock, which contributed to the event of copyright rock, affected via the countercultural copyright and hippie scene.
The founders of Southern rock are often regarded as the Allman Brothers Band, who formulated a particular seem, largely derived from blues rock, but incorporating elements of boogie, soul, and country inside the early 1970s.[one hundred] Quite possibly the most successful act to comply with them had been Lynyrd Skynyrd, who assisted build the "Good ol' boy" graphic from the subgenre and the general shape of seventies' guitar rock.

Jaco Pastorius of Climate Report in click here 1980 While in the late sixties, jazz-rock emerged as a distinct subgenre out on the blues-rock, copyright, and progressive rock scenes, mixing the power of rock Together with the musical complexity and improvisational things of jazz. AllMusic states that the expression jazz-rock "may possibly confer with the loudest, wildest, most electrified fusion bands within the jazz camp, but most often it describes performers coming with the rock aspect in the equation." Jazz-rock "...generally grew away from quite possibly the most artistically ambitious rock subgenres of your late '60s and early '70s", such as the singer-songwriter movement.[136] Lots of early US rock and roll musicians experienced begun in jazz and carried Many of these elements in the new music.
